Olivier Nineuil, TYPOFACTO

Founding Partner

Founder of Typofacto, Olivier Nineuil is a typeface designer, author, editor and workshop animator
on typographic creation.
He designs exclusive fonts to order, for artists, publishers and companies. He has created the Air
France, Club Med, Michelin typefaces, those of the French National Olympic Committee, the
French Tennis Federation, the French Handball team and in the field of publishing, the Jean Giono
typeface for Hatier or the Grévisse font for Magnard.
Alongside these creations, Olivier Nineuil teaches type design and what he calls “typographic
maieutics” in various art schools. Committed to the promotion of typographic heritage and the
transmission of know-how, Olivier Nineuil leads within Typofacto, a publishing activity, dedicated
to the field of writing (monographs, essays, fiction, children’s books).
It is in this desire for transmission that he intervenes within Format A5, a group of graphic arts
professionals, who share their expertise and their passion for print during conferences and
training sessions.
